What does help mean?
Definitions in simple English

help

If you help another person do something, you do things to make it easier for them to do the thing, or you do part of it for them. Will you please help me wash the dishes? If you can't help doing something or can't help but do it, you cannot avoid it. You do it even without wanting or planning to. When I look at the class, I can not help feeling that something has gone wrong. They agreed that it was good, but I can't help wondering, "good for who?"

help

Help is the act of helping. Will you please give me some help? This is hard for just one person to do. The help is people who work in a home cooking, cleaning, etc. The help arrives as 9 o' clock.
